Know what to look for when choosing a campsite-
When choosing for a campsite we should look for places that are flat and dry. If the ground is rough there might be sharp objects poking through the tent that may cause discomfort or injuries to the camper. The camp site must also be dry to prevent damage low-lying land can also increase the chances of flooding so finding campsites with good drainage grass is good as the plants can help to absorb water reducing the chance for it to flood. Another variable is what is around you there might be trees with broken branches and it is important that you do not camp under trees in open areas to prevent damage to tents and injuries to campers.

Show understanding of the principles of camp hygiene and the importance of order and cleanliness in camp generally- Cleaning the campsite is important so that during the camp the camper does not get sick. A way that campers can keep their area clean is using camp gadgets by using these camp gadgets we can hang our clothes and shoes in an orderly manner so that the clothes do not have an odour and have a negative impact on the camper. Another way is to pick up rubbish and dispose of it so as to keep a clean and safe campsite this can prevent bugs and insects from coming to our campsite if there is food waste. There should be regular hygiene practices like bathing and brushing their teeth if any of these were to be skipped there would be foul smells and may cause discomfort to other campers
Demonstrate how to store food and equipment in an organised manner- For perishable food, it has to be wrapped in cling wrap or stored in an airtight container so as to not let the water from the meat contaminate the other foods. Canned food can be stored if they are in good condition and not expired. Unused food should be kept in containers and out of reach of animals such as monkeys and wild boars. Raw food should be separated to prevent cross contamination. Mess tins and cutting boards should be tilted down when drying so as to let excess water flow down and let it easier to dry. Equipment such as gas canisters should not be left out in the sunlight for too long and should be kept in the shade.
